如何将200个文件/数据/内容直接导出为纯文本格式?——一键复制粘贴的终极指南
在日常工作中,我们常常需要处理大量数据、文档或内容,并希望将它们以最简洁、最易复制的形式导出为纯文本格式,无论是为了备份、分享、数据分析,还是为了导入其他系统,纯文本文件(如.txt格式)因其简洁性和兼容性,成为了许多场景下的首选,本文将为你提供从手动到自动化的多种方法,帮助你轻松将200个文件或内容导出为纯文本,实现一键复制粘贴的便捷操作。
什么是纯文本导出?
纯文本(Plain Text)是指不包含任何格式(如字体、颜色、表格、图片等)的文本内容,它通常以.txt为扩展名,可以在任何文本编辑器(如记事本、VS Code、Sublime Text等)中打开和编辑,纯文本文件的优势在于:
- 兼容性强:几乎所有软件和系统都支持纯文本格式。
- 体积小:相比富文本或格式化文档,纯文本文件更轻量。
- 易于复制粘贴:无需担心格式错乱,直接复制即可使用。
手动导出纯文本的方法
如果你只有少量文件(比如少于200个),手动导出是最简单直接的方式,以下是几种常见的手动导出方法:
-
从Word或PPT中复制粘贴
- 打开Word或PPT文档。
- 按
Ctrl+A,然后按Ctrl+C复制。 - 在文本编辑器(如记事本)中粘贴(
Ctrl+V)。 - 保存为
.txt文件。
-
从PDF中提取文本
- 使用PDF阅读器(如Adobe Acrobat、Foxit Reader)打开PDF文件。
- 使用“选择工具”选中文本,然后复制粘贴到文本编辑器中。
- 或者使用在线PDF转文本工具(如Smallpdf、iLovePDF)批量处理。
-
从Excel中导出为纯文本
- 打开Excel文件。
- 点击“文件”→“另存为”。
- 在“保存类型”中选择“文本(制表符分隔)”或“CSV(逗号分隔)”。
- 保存后,可以用记事本打开查看。
批量导出纯文本的自动化方法
如果你需要处理200个文件,手动操作会非常耗时,以下是几种批量导出纯文本的自动化方法:
-
使用脚本批量处理
-
Python脚本:如果你熟悉编程,可以使用Python的
os模块或第三方库(如pandas)批量处理文件。import os def export_to_text(file_path, output_path): with open(file_path, 'r', encoding='utf-8') as f: content = f.read() with open(output_path, 'w', encoding='utf-8') as f_out: f_out.write(content) # 示例:遍历文件夹中的所有文件并导出为纯文本 folder_path = 'your_folder_path' output_folder = 'output_folder_path' for filename in os.listdir(folder_path): if filename.endswith('.docx') or filename.endswith('.pdf') or filename.endswith('.xlsx'): file_path = os.path.join(folder_path, filename) output_path = os.path.join(output_folder, os.path.splitext(filename)[0] + '.txt') export_to_text(file_path, output_path) -
PowerShell脚本:Windows用户可以使用PowerShell批量处理文件。
-
-
使用办公软件的批量功能
- Microsoft Word:可以使用宏(Macro)批量将多个文档导出为纯文本。
- Google Docs:将文档另存为“纯文本”格式(.txt),然后批量下载。
-
使用在线工具或第三方软件
- 在线批量转换工具:如CloudConvert、 Zamzar等网站支持批量将多种格式文件转换为纯文本。
- 专业转换软件:如Adobe Acrobat Pro、福昕高级PDF编辑器等,提供批量导出功能。
注意事项与技巧
- 编码问题:导出纯文本时,注意选择正确的编码格式(如UTF-8、GBK),避免中文乱码。
- 格式清理:如果导出的文本包含多余空格、换行或特殊字符,可以在文本编辑器中手动清理,或使用正则表达式批量替换。
- 备份原文件:在批量处理前,建议先备份原文件,防止操作失误导致数据丢失。
- 分批处理:如果文件数量庞大,建议分批处理,避免程序崩溃或系统卡顿。
将200个文件或内容导出为纯文本并不复杂,无论是手动操作还是自动化处理,都能轻松实现,根据你的技术能力和需求,选择合适的方法即可,如果你需要更高效的解决方案,建议尝试编写脚本或使用专业工具,大幅提升工作效率。
如果你有具体的文件类型或格式需求,欢迎进一步说明,我可以为你提供更详细的指导!

-- 展开阅读全文 --

